当前位置: 首页>>技术教程>>正文


boot – SYSLINUX:未找到 DEFAULT 或 UI 配置指令!

, ,

问题描述

我有一个使用 Linux Live USB 创建器创建的 USB 实时密钥。我使用了所有默认值,并获得了标准版本的 Ubuntu。当我尝试启动它时,我收到上面的错误。我经历了其余的线程,但无济于事。

我尝试过的事情:

  • 重命名文件(我的文件已经是 syslinux.cfg 等)

  • 在 boot:__ 提示符中输入 mboot.c32 -c boot.cfg

任何帮助,将不胜感激!

最佳思路

一般回答

通常,打算从 CD/DVD 刻录和引导的 iso 映像在 isolinux 文件夹中具有引导所需的所有文件。而打算从 USB 运行的 iso 映像在 syslinux 文件夹中具有启动所需的所有文件。因此,当您尝试从 USB 刻录和引导 CD/DVD iso 时,它无法识别引导介质的类型,因为它没有 syslinux 文件夹,它只会给出 Boot failure : No DEFAULT or UI configuration directive found!

错误的一般解决方案

打开 USB 安装媒体,然后重命名以下内容:

isolinux –> syslinux (folder)
isolinux.bin –> syslinux.bin
isolinux.cfg –> syslinux.cfg

系统在设备根目录的 syslinux 文件夹中查找这两个文件(.bin 和 .cfg)。因此,请确保您在 syslinux 文件夹中拥有这两个文件。

次佳思路

我一直有完全相同的问题。我尝试使用 YUMI 和 Unebootin 制作 USB Live 时出现相同的错误错误:

SYSLINUX:未找到 DEFAULT 或 UI 配置指令!

我试过

  1. 将 isolinux 等更改为 syslinux (通过复制粘贴,所以没有拼写错误)

  2. 将 USB 格式化为 FAT16 而不是 FAT32

  3. 将 USB 格式化为 FAT16 而不是 FAT32 并重命名这些文件(复制粘贴)

都失败了。

然后我尝试使用 Universal USB Creator(与 YUMI 相同,但 Windows 版本),它的工作原理!

如果您尝试的所有方法都失败了,只需提供替代建议!

第三种思路

似乎每个人都有不同的解决方案,对我来说,解决方案是使用 FAT 文件系统格式化我的闪存驱动器,并使用通用 USB 安装程序制作启动驱动器,瞧,就像一个魅力。

参考资料

本文由Ubuntu问答整理, 博文地址: https://ubuntuqa.com/article/12979.html,未经允许,请勿转载。